Abstract
A kind of stainless steel pipes adpting flange, is made up of first flange body and second flange body;Described first flange body is identical with second flange body structure;Described stainless steel pipes end set has projection;The located space of stainless steel pipes and projection is formed between described first flange body and second flange body;The circumferential area size of described located space is less than the cylindrical circumferential area size sum of stainless steel pipes and projection;Described first flange body includes large flange face;" Ω " shape boss is provided with described large flange side;It is provided with described " Ω " shape boss for penetrating bolted through hole between first flange body and second flange body;Described located space includes the groove with the groove of the cylindrical cooperation of projection and with the cylindrical cooperation of stainless steel pipes;Not only easy installation and removal, structural strength is high, and after stainless steel pipes wear, does not influence the use of first flange body and second flange body, reduce use cost.

Background technology
Flange is the part being connected with each other between pipeline and pipeline, for the connection between pipe end;There is bolt hole on flange,
Two flanges are adjacent to by bolt, reach the purpose of connecting pipe;Flange connection is easy to use, can bear larger pressure,
In industrial pipeline, the use of flange connection is quite varied, but common flange is welded on pipeline, is one whole with pipeline
Body, it is difficult to dismantle flange, when pipeline wears, flange must be changed together with pipeline, improve use cost;Made in processing
Because pipeline is longer when making, flange outer diameter is larger compared to pipeline, so after must processing flange and pipeline respectively, then assemble weldering
Connect, cause accumulated error.

Embodiment
The utility model is further described below in conjunction with the accompanying drawings;
In the accompanying drawings:A kind of adpting flange of stainless steel pipes 101, is made up of first flange body 1 and second flange body 2;Institute
The first flange body 1 stated is identical with the structure of second flange body 2;The described end of stainless steel pipes 101 is welded with projection 3;It is described
Projection 3 be not only easy to position with first flange body 1 and second flange body 2, and serve and seal between stainless steel pipes 101
Effect;The located space 4 of stainless steel pipes 101 and projection 3 is formed between described first flange body 1 and second flange body 2;
The circumferential area size of described located space 4 is less than the cylindrical circumferential area size sum of stainless steel pipes 101 and projection 3,
It is easy to first flange body 1 and second flange body 2 to compress rust steel conduit 101 and projection 3 during its purpose, in actual use, due to
Itself wall of stainless steel pipes 101 is thin, typically without processing, so stainless steel pipes 101 are cylindrical irregular, in first flange body
1 and second flange body 2 when being connected with stainless steel pipes 101 and projection 3, based on projection 3, stainless steel pipes 101 are stress point
It is auxiliary;Not only easy installation and removal, structural strength is high, and after stainless steel pipes wear, does not influence first flange body and second
The use of flange body, reduces use cost.
In Fig. 2, Fig. 3:Described first flange body 1 includes large flange face 1-1;On described large flange face 1-1 sides
It is provided with " Ω " shape boss 1-2;Be provided with described " Ω " shape boss 1-2 for first flange body 1 and second flange body 2 it
Between penetrate bolted through hole 1-3;Dismounting is easily installed, structural strength is high.
In Fig. 2, Fig. 3, Fig. 4:Described located space 4 includes the groove 4-1 and and stainless steel with 3 cylindrical cooperation of projection
The groove 4-2 of 101 cylindrical cooperation of pipeline;Described groove 4-1 external diameter is more than groove 4-2 external diameter;It is easy to and stainless steel tube
Road 101 and projection 3 coordinate, and positioning precision is high.
